Subject: Re: [PATCH v2 06/12] drm/rockchip: vop2: rename grf to sys_grf
Date: Mon, 27 Nov 2023 15:17:37 +0100 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20231127141737.GG977968@pengutronix.de>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20231122125454.3454671-1-andyshrk@163.com>
On Wed, Nov 22, 2023 at 08:54:54PM +0800, Andy Yan wrote:
> From: Andy Yan <andy.yan@rock-chips.com>
>
> The vop2 need to reference more grf(system grf, vop grf, vo0/1 grf,etc)
> in the upcoming rk3588.
>
> So we rename the current system grf to sys_grf.
>
> Signed-off-by: Andy Yan <andy.yan@rock-chips.com>
Reviewed-by: Sascha Hauer <s.hauer@pengutronix.de>
